Is Coppull a good place to live?
Coppull may be a good fit for people who value lower house prices. It ranks strongly for lower house prices, while flood risk is around the national middle range and crime is around the national middle range. Transport access appears weaker, so those factors are worth checking against your priorities.

Crime rate in Coppull
Crime rate
Crime rate
14.95 per 1,000 people
Percentile
50th percentile nationally
Crime levels are around the national middle range.
House prices in Coppull
House prices
Average sold price
£138,867
Percentile
6th percentile nationally
House prices appear lower than many neighbourhoods nationally.

Is Coppull safe?
Coppull ranks in the 50th percentile for crime data; in this dataset, a higher percentile indicates lower crime.
What are house prices like in Coppull?
The average sold price is £138,867, with house prices in the 6th percentile nationally.
How are schools in Coppull?
Schools rank in the 69th percentile nationally for this public profile.
